How to Determine the Right Solar System Size for Your Tampa Home?

Determining the Right Solar System Size for Your Tampa Home is essential to maximize its energy production and cost savings. Several factors need consideration when determining the right size for your solar system.

Firstly, you should assess your average electricity consumption. Review your utility bills from the past year and identify your monthly kilowatt-hours (kWh) usage. This information will help determine the size of the solar system you need to offset most, if not all, of your electricity usage.

Next, evaluate the available roof space for solar panel installation. Ensure there is sufficient unobstructed space where panels can be installed facing south or southwest for optimal sunlight exposure. Roof orientation and shading can affect energy production, so consider these factors carefully.

Additionally, consider your future energy needs. If you plan on expanding your household or adding appliances that require more electricity, it’s wise to account for these potential changes. A slightly larger solar system may be a good investment, ensuring your energy needs are met even as they grow.

How can I determine the optimal size of a solar system for my home or business in Tampa?

When determining the optimal size of a solar system for your home or business in Tampa, there are several factors to consider:

1. **Energy consumption:** Start by assessing your average monthly energy consumption. Look at your utility bills over the past year and determine how much electricity you typically use.

2. **Roof suitability:** Evaluate the suitability of your roof for solar panels. Consider factors such as orientation, shade from nearby buildings or trees, and available roof space. A south-facing roof with minimal shade is ideal for maximizing solar generation.

3. **Solar resource:** Research the solar resource potential in your area. Tampa has abundant sunshine throughout the year, making it a favorable location for solar energy production.

4. **System size:** Based on your energy consumption and roof suitability, calculate the system size needed to meet your electricity needs. This can be done by considering the average daily sunlight hours in Tampa and the efficiency of solar panels.

5. **Financial considerations:** Determine your budget and financial goals. Consider the initial investment, available incentives, such as federal tax credits, and potential long-term savings on your electricity bills.

What factors should I consider when calculating how much solar energy I need to power my Tampa-based property efficiently?

When calculating how much solar energy you need to power your property efficiently in Tampa, there are several factors to consider:

1. Energy consumption: Determine your average monthly energy consumption by reviewing your utility bills. This will help you estimate the size of the solar system you need.

2. Roof space: Assess the available roof space for installing solar panels. Consider factors such as orientation, shading, and structural limitations that may affect the efficiency of the system.

3. Solar panel efficiency: Different solar panels have varying levels of efficiency. Higher efficiency panels can generate more electricity in limited space, which may be beneficial if you have limited roof space.

4. Solar irradiance: Tampa has abundant sunshine, but it is important to consider the local climate and solar irradiance data. This information will help you estimate the amount of sunlight reaching your property throughout the year.

5. Battery storage: Evaluate whether you want to install a battery storage system to store excess solar energy. This can be useful for powering your property during nighttime or cloudy days.

6. Financial considerations: Determine your budget and consider the cost of installation, any applicable incentives or tax credits, and potential long-term savings from switching to solar energy.

Are there any local regulations or utility requirements in Tampa that I should be aware of when determining the size of my solar installation?

In Tampa, there are several local regulations and utility requirements that you should be aware of when determining the size of your solar installation.

Firstly, it is important to check with the local building department or permitting office to understand the specific requirements for solar installations in your area. They may have guidelines regarding setbacks, mounting systems, and interconnection procedures.

Additionally, the utility company in Tampa, such as Tampa Electric Company (TECO), may have specific requirements for connecting your solar system to the grid. This could include completing an interconnection application, meeting certain technical standards, and potentially paying fees. It is recommended to reach out to your utility provider early on in the planning process to ensure compliance with their requirements.

Moreover, Tampa and the state of Florida have laws and regulations related to net metering, which allows solar system owners to receive credits for excess energy they produce and feed back into the grid. Understanding these net metering policies will help you determine the optimal size of your solar installation based on your energy needs and potential energy generation.
